Trial set for ND man accused of killing brother

GRAND FORKS, N.D. (AP) — Trial is scheduled to start Feb. 8 for a rural Manvel man accused of killing his brother in a dispute over property.

The Grand Forks Herald reports that a separate trial on theft charges against 45-year-old Rodney Chisholm is to begin Jan. 11.

Chisholm has pleaded not guilty to a murder charge and five felony theft counts linked to stolen farm equipment that authorities say they found in his possession.

Chisholm is accused of killing his 59-year-old brother, Donald, in late June by either hitting him in the head with a metal pipe, strangling him or a combination of the two. Chisholm says he acted in self-defense.
